Organizations Education Bakersfield Christian High School

Bakersfield Christian High School

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on February 4, 2025.

12775 Stockdale Highway
Bakersfield, California 93314

Bakersfield Christian High School (EIN: 77-0121197)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Bakersfield Christian High School,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 5 out of 174 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$143,718. The highest compensated employee at Bakersfield Christian High School is Matt Guinn with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$240,000.

Mission Statement

TO OFFER OUR COMMUNITY A NON-DENOMINATIONAL SCHOOL OF EXCELLENCE, PROVIDING A BIBLICALLY-BASED EDUCATION FOR STUDENTS FROM GRADES 9-12. THIS IS A COLLEGE PREPARATORY HIGH SCHOOL. OVER 95% OF OUR STUDENTS GO ON TO COLLEGE.
